Below is a clear, <strong>beginner-friendly step-by-step text tutorial<\/strong> for a versatile lace <strong>edge<\/strong> you can use on shawls, blouses, table runners, blankets \u2014 or make as a repeating strip and sew it on. It creates a row of pointed leaf-scallops with little picot dots and a tidy base that sits flat. I give exact repeats, a corner method, blocking\/finishing, troubleshooting and quick variations so you can start crocheting immediately.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Materials &amp; gauge<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Yarn:<\/strong> fingering \u2192 DK (cotton for crisp edge; acrylic\/wool for drape).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Hook:<\/strong> 2.5\u20134.5 mm depending on yarn (use yarn label as starting point). For lacy look use a slightly larger hook than label; for a firm trim use the label hook or slightly smaller.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Notions:<\/strong> tapestry needle, blocking pins\/towel, scissors.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Suggested test: make 6 repeats and block \u2014 adjust hook or spacing until you like the look.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Abbreviations (US terms)<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>ch \u2014 chain<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>sl st \u2014 slip stitch<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>sc \u2014 single crochet<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>hdc \u2014 half double crochet<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>dc \u2014 double crochet<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>tr \u2014 treble crochet<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>pic \u2014 picot (ch 3, sl st into base)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>sp \u2014 space<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>st(s) \u2014 stitch(es)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>rep \u2014 repeat<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"576\" src=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image-4-7-1024x576.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-10493\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image-4-7-1024x576.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image-4-7-300x169.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image-4-7-768x432.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image-4-7.jpeg 1280w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Pattern concept &amp; repeat<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Repeat multiple:<\/strong> 6 sts (you can change spacing by increasing\/decreasing base sc between repeats).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>This edge works best attached to a finished base row of <strong>sc<\/strong> (one sc per fabric stitch or spaced to taste). If you\u2019re adding to an existing garment, first work an even row of sc along the edge to create a tidy foundation.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Attachment preparation (two options)<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>A \u2014 Work onto finished fabric:<\/strong> work 1 round of sc evenly along the raw edge (anchor points for lace).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>B \u2014 Make a border strip from chain:<\/strong> ch a multiple of <strong>6 + 2<\/strong> (example ch 38 for 6 repeats: 6\u00d76 + 2 = 38). Row 1: sc in 2nd ch from hook and across \u2014 now you have a base sc row to work the lace into.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Edge Pattern \u2014 round-by-round<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Round 1 \u2014 set anchor loops<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Working into the base sc row (either attached fabric or strip):<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><em>Sc in next 3 sc, ch 3, sk 2 sc<\/em> \u2014 repeat across until the end.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>End by sc in the last 1\u20132 sc to square the row.<br><strong>Check:<\/strong> you should have a small ch-3 loop every ~3\u20134 base stitches \u2014 one loop per leaf unit.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" src=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-15-1024x1024.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-10494\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-15-1024x1024.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-15-300x300.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-15-150x150.jpeg 150w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-15-768x768.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-15.jpeg 1080w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Round 2 \u2014 leaf body (main decorative round)<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Into each ch-3 loop work this leaf stitch set <strong>all into the same loop<\/strong>: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><code>(sc, hdc, 3 dc, tr, 3 dc, hdc, sc)<\/code><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Then <strong>sl st<\/strong> into the next base sc to anchor, <em>sc in next 2 sc, ch 3, sk 2 sc<\/em> and repeat leaf in the next loop.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>sc \u2014 neat base<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>hdc \u2014 shoulder shaping<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>3 dc \u2014 left side of leaf<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>tr \u2014 tall center (midrib)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>3 dc \u2014 mirror to right side<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>hdc, sc \u2014 tidy finish<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Repeat<\/strong> across the row.<br><strong>Check:<\/strong> you should see neat pointed leaf scallops sitting on the edge.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Round 3 \u2014 tip picots &amp; tidy base<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Join yarn at the top of any leaf (or pick up in last sl st).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>For each leaf tip: <em>sl st into the tr (tip), <strong>ch 3, sl st into same st<\/strong> (picot)<\/em> \u2014 this makes a tiny dot at each point.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>After placing a picot, <strong>work sc 2<\/strong> across the small base between leaves (or <code>sl st + sc<\/code> depending on spacing) to tidy the underside.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Continue around; fasten off and weave in ends.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Alternative finish:<\/strong> replace single picot with <code>(sc, ch 3, sc)<\/code> for a little bud rather than a dot.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Corners (turning a rectangular piece)<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>At each corner of your project: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>After working the last full scallop on the side, <strong>make a corner loop<\/strong>: ch 6 (or ch 4 for tighter corner \/ ch 8 for gentler corner), then continue the leaf repeats along the next side anchoring the first leaf into that corner loop (work first leaf cluster into the ch-6). This gives a smooth, decorative corner.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" src=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-1-16-1024x1024.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-10495\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-1-16-1024x1024.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-1-16-300x300.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-1-16-150x150.jpeg 150w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-1-16-768x768.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-1-16.jpeg 1080w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Joining the strip to fabric (if using Option B)<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Align strip to fabric edge. Sew with fine whipstitch or mattress stitch through the base sc row and the garment edge.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Or <strong>crochet on<\/strong>: hold strip to edge and work sc through both the fabric edge and the base sc of the strip to attach.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Blocking &amp; finishing<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Pin each leaf so tips are pointed and picots are crisp. Pull corners into shape if used. Mist with water and let dry thoroughly.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>For very crisp trims (table linens), apply a light starch or diluted PVA\/sugar solution after blocking \u2014 test on a scrap first.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Troubleshooting &amp; adjustments<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Edge waves (too many scallops):<\/strong> reduce number of scallops per inch by increasing space between anchor loops \u2014 e.g., <code>sc 4, ch 3, sk 3<\/code> instead of <code>sc 3, ch 3, sk 2<\/code>.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Points curl up (cup):<\/strong> use slightly longer central tr or larger picots, or block more firmly. If persistent, loosen tension (larger hook) during leaf rounds.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Edge flattens \/ loses shape:<\/strong> shorten picots (ch 2) or use smaller hook on Round 3 to pull tips taut.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Uneven scallops:<\/strong> ensure you\u2019re working the same stitches into each ch-3 loop and count first 3\u20134 repeats to set rhythm.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" src=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-2-5-1024x1024.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-10496\" srcset=\"https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-2-5-1024x1024.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-2-5-300x300.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-2-5-150x150.jpeg 150w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-2-5-768x768.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/sntnews3.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/12\/Untitled-image_01-2-5.jpeg 1080w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Quick variations<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Petite edge (smaller):<\/strong> change <code>3 dc<\/code> \u2192 <code>2 dc<\/code> and <code>tr<\/code> \u2192 <code>dc<\/code>. Use smaller hook\/finer yarn.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Fuller leaves:<\/strong> change <code>3 dc<\/code> \u2192 <code>5 dc<\/code> and make ch-4 anchors (gives big dramatic leaves).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Two-colour:<\/strong> work base sc row in color A; switch to color B for leaf body to make leaves pop.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Beaded edge:<\/strong> thread small beads onto yarn before crocheting and slip a bead onto the central tr of each leaf for sparkle.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Uses &amp; layout ideas<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Shawl \/ scarf:<\/strong> repeat the edge along two long sides; for triangle shawl work along the long edge only.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Blouse neckline \/ hem:<\/strong> make narrower\/petite version to trim necklines or sleeve cuffs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Runner \/ table:<\/strong> make long strip and join strips end-to-end or crochet two strips and sew\/attach to both sides of fabric.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Appliqu\u00e9 leaves:<\/strong> make single leaf motif (magic loop, then <code>(sc, hdc, 3 dc, tr, 3 dc, hdc, sc)<\/code>) and sew them on as decorative motifs.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>VIDEO: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-embed is-type-video is-provider-youtube wp-block-embed-youtube wp-embed-aspect-16-9 wp-has-aspect-ratio\"><div class=\"wp-block-embed__wrapper\">\n<iframe loading=\"lazy\" title=\"This Crochet Pattern is Amazing\ud83c\udf3f Multi-Purpose Edge Lace Pattern\" width=\"1200\" height=\"675\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/Q4Q698TpzA0?feature=oembed\" frameborder=\"0\" allow=\"accelerometer; autoplay; clipboard-write; encrypted-media; gyroscope; picture-in-picture; web-share\" referrerpolicy=\"strict-origin-when-cross-origin\" allowfullscreen><\/iframe>\n<\/div><\/figure>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Lovely!
